Output 68764dada11228c405bf0b76f577817efc69a4faa8b31e5382c71b3325939491:1

value
276232230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df40ab0dbc88c663deb1bc2d81484b2673f4463 OP_EQUALVERIFY OP_CHECKSIG
address
1JKP4aLZ6QS6tMsDoA1hdKqJd1pyca9v7j
transaction
68764dada11228c405bf0b76f577817efc69a4faa8b31e5382c71b3325939491
spent
true